Title :
A hybrid approach to investigate central kitchen green performance in uncertainty
Author :
Wang, Ray ; Hung, Li-Mei
Abstract :
In recent years, environmental consciousness is on the rise. Many scholars have addressed environmental issues and green performances posed have begun to be studied. There is growing importance for green performance requested from customers, government, non-governmental organizations, and stakeholders in hospitality industry. The managers should not ignore the environmental problems that may have impact. Therefore, the green supply chain management has become an important issue. There are no clear quantitative indicators to decide the level of greenness of business yet, however, even scarcity of literature on how the analytic framework in uncertainty with dependence and interactive relationships should be properly implemented. This study proposes a hybrid approach -using the analytic network process (ANP) analyze the dependence aspects, the importance performance analysis (IPA) to draw implications for managing green performance criteria and applies fuzzy set theory to evaluate the uncertainty. Four dependence aspects and thirty-four interactive criteria are evaluated a well-know central kitchen in Chinese Taipei. The results and concluding remarks are discussed.
